Robert_A._Plane

Robert Allen Plane (1927 – August 6, 2018) was an American retired chemistry professor and college administrator. He served as Provost of Cornell University from 1969 to 1973 and president and chief executive officer of Clarkson University from 1974 until 1985. From 1991 to 1995, he was president of Wells College.Plane graduated from Evansville College (now called University of Evansville) in Indiana in 1948 with a bachelor's degree, and from the University of Chicago in 1951 with a doctorate.

Nevin_S._Scrimshaw

Nevin Stewart Scrimshaw (January 20, 1918 – February 8, 2013) was an American food scientist and Institute Professor emeritus at the Massachusetts Institute of Technology. Scrimshaw was born in Milwaukee, Wisconsin. During the course of his long career he developed nutritional supplements for alleviating protein, iodine, and iron deficiencies in the developing world. His pioneering and extensive publications in the area of human nutrition and food science include over 20 books and monographs and hundreds of scholarly articles. Scrimshaw also founded the Department of Nutrition and Food Science at the Massachusetts Institute of Technology, the Institute of Nutrition of Central America and Panama, and the Nevin Scrimshaw International Nutrition Foundation. He was awarded the Bolton L. Corson Medal in 1976 and the World Food Prize in 1991. Scrimshaw spent the last years of his life on a farm in Thornton, New Hampshire, where he died at 95.

Leonard_Parker

Leonard Emanuel Parker (born Leonard Pearlman; in 1938) is a distinguished professor emeritus of physics and a former director of the Center for Gravitation and Cosmology at the University of Wisconsin–Milwaukee. During the late 1960s, Parker established a new area of physics—quantum field theory in curved spacetime. Specifically, by applying the technique of Bogoliubov transformations to quantum field theory with a changing gravitational field, he discovered the physical mechanism now known as cosmological particle production. His breakthrough discovery has a surprising consequence: the expansion of the universe can create particles out of the vacuum.
His work inspired research by hundreds of physicists and has been cited in more than 2,000 research papers; it was credited in the memoirs of Soviet physicist Andrei Sakharov and helped Stephen Hawking discover the creation of particles by black holes.Along with David Toms of Newcastle University, Parker co-wrote a latest addition to graduate-level textbooks on quantum field theory in curved spacetime, entitled Quantum Field Theory in Curved Spacetime: Quantized Fields and Gravity (Cambridge University Press, 2009, ISBN 978-0-521-87787-9).
He received his PhD from Harvard University in 1967. His advisor was Sidney Coleman.

Herman_Kahn

Herman Kahn (February 15, 1922 – July 7, 1983) was an American physicist and a founding member of the Hudson Institute, regarded as one of the preeminent futurists of the latter part of the twentieth century. He originally came to prominence as a military strategist and systems theorist while employed at the RAND Corporation. He analyzed the likely consequences of nuclear war and recommended ways to improve survivability during the Cold War. Kahn posited the idea of a "winnable" nuclear exchange in his 1960 book On Thermonuclear War for which he was one of the historical inspirations for the title character of Stanley Kubrick's classic black comedy film satire Dr. Strangelove. In his commentary for Fail Safe, director Sidney Lumet remarked that the Professor Groeteschele character is also based on Herman Kahn.
Kahn's theories contributed to the development of the nuclear strategy of the United States.
